Halifax Drive is in Worcester and in Worcester district. WR2 4DR is located in the Lower Wick & Pitmaston elect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Worcester.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. The area surrounding WR2 4DR has a slightly higher male population, with 50.5% of residents being male. Several factors can contribute to this, including areas with industries or sectors that predominantly employ men, proximity to universities or technical schools with a higher enrollment of male students, presence of all-male or predominantly male institutions (military academies, boarding schools).

Partnership Status

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.

In the immediate vicinity of WR2 4DR there is a very large concentration of residents that are married - 54% of the resident population. In contrast, the average marriage rate across the census is about 44%.

Areas with a high percentage of married residents are typically suburban neighborhoods, towns with good schools and family-friendly amenities, and regions with affordable, spacious housing options. Additionally, such areas can be popular among retirees.

Safety

Is Halifax Drive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Halifax Drive was 6.6 per 1,000 residents, which is 94.2% lower than the Dines Green & Grove Farm average. The most reported crime type was Anti-social behaviour.

Halifax Drive has the 4th lowest crime rate of 55 local areas in Dines Green & Grove Farm and the 12th lowest crime rate of 330 local areas in Worcester .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 3.3 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-52.5%.

Employment

WR2 4DR area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 2%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.

The percentage of retired residents living in WR2 4DR area is much higher than the country's average. According to Census 2011, 37% residents of this area were retired, while the average in the UK was 14%.
